Introduction
The MEAN WELL DDR series comprises DIN rail-type DC-DC converters featuring easy DIN rail installation, ultra-slim width, 2:1 wide input voltage range, fanless design, and a wide operating temperature range (-40~+70°C, or -40~+80°C for DDR-480 series). They offer 4kVdc I/O isolation, 150% peak load capability, current sharing, DC OK signal, adjustable output voltage, and comprehensive protective functions.
This series supports various input voltage options: 9~18V, 16.8~33.6V, 33.6~67.2V, and 67.2~154V, with output options of 12V, 24V, and 48V. They are suitable for applications in industrial and railway control, security systems, communication systems, and other fields, including DC buck/boost regulation, increasing system insulation levels, and voltage drop compensation along cables.

Installation
General Guidelines
Always allow adequate ventilation clearances: 5mm on the left and right, 40mm above, and 20mm below the unit during operation to prevent overheating.
Mounting Orientation
The recommended mounting orientation is vertical, with input terminals at the bottom and output terminals at the top. Mounting orientations such as upside down, horizontal, or table-top mounting are not permitted.
Wiring and Connections
Use copper wire only. Recommended wire gauges and their corresponding current ratings are as follows:
AWG | 18 | 16 | 14 | 12 | 10 |
---|---|---|---|---|---|
Rated Current of Equipment (Amp) | 7A | 10A | 15A | 20A | 30A |
Cross-section of Lead (mm²) | 0.8 | 1.3 | 2.1 | 3.3 | 5.3 |
Notes:
- The current capacity for each wire should be de-rated to 80% of the suggested value when using 5 or more wires connected to the unit.
- The maximum allowable wire cross-sectional area for the terminal is 12AWG/2.5 mm².
Ensure that all strands of each stranded wire are fully inserted into the terminal connection and that the screw terminals are securely tightened to prevent poor contact. If the power supply has multiple output terminals, ensure each contact is connected to wires to prevent excessive current stress on a single contact.
Use wires rated for at least 80°C, such as UL1007.
Recommended wire strapping length is 5mm (0.197 inches).
Recommended screwdriver is a 4mm slotted type.
Terminal Torque Settings
The recommended torque settings for the terminals are:
Model | Input (I/P) Torque | Output (O/P) Torque |
---|---|---|
DDR-120 | 6.9 kgf-cm (6 Lb-in) | 6.9 kgf-cm (6 Lb-in) |
DDR-240 | 8.06 kgf-cm (7 Lb-in) | 5.13 kgf-cm (4.45 Lb-in) |
DDR-480 | 10.3 kgf-cm (9 Lb-in) | 8.06 kgf-cm (7 Lb-in) |

Mounting Instructions
Mount the unit as shown in the figures, with input terminals facing downwards, to ensure adequate cooling. If mounted in other orientations, sufficient cooling may not be possible.
Admissible DIN rail type: TS35/7.5 or TS35/15.
For rail fastening:
- Tilt the unit slightly rearwards.
- Fit the unit over the top hat rail.
- Slide it downward until it hits the stop.
- Press against the bottom for locking.
- Shake the unit slightly to confirm the locking action.
Warnings and Cautions
Please observe the following safety precautions:
- Risk of electrical shock and energy hazard: All failures should be examined by a qualified technician. Do not attempt to remove the power supply case yourself.
- Risk of electric arcs and electric shock (danger to life): Connecting both the primary and secondary sides together is not allowed.
- Risk of burn hazard: Do not touch the unit during operation or immediately after disconnection.
- Risk of fire and short circuit: Ensure openings are protected from foreign objects and dripping liquids.
- Install the unit only in a pollution degree 2 environment (Note 1).
- Do not install the unit in places with high moisture or near water.
- The maximum operating temperatures are 55°C for DDR-120 series, 50°C for DDR-240 series, and 60°C for DDR-480 series. Avoid installing the unit in places with high ambient temperatures or near fire sources.
- The FG (Protective Earth) terminal must be connected to PE (Protective Earth).
- Output current and output wattage must not exceed the rated values specified.
- Disconnect system from supply voltage: Before commencing any installation, maintenance, or modification work, disconnect the system from the supply voltage. Ensure that inadvertent reconnection into the circuit is impossible.
- For continued protection against fire risk, replace fuses only with the same type and rating. (To avoid compromising fire protection, replace with a fuse of the same type and nominal characteristics.)
Note 1: Pollution Degree 2 applies to environments where only non-conductive pollution is present, which might temporarily become conductive due to occasional condensation. Generally, this refers to dry, well-ventilated locations such as control cabinets.
